Instructing SMS to Create a Management Information
Format File at Deployment Time
Task:
To instruct SMS to create a Management Information Format (MIF) file at deployment time:
1.
From the checklist, select Package, and then select SMS from the second column. The SMS View of the
Package View opens.
2.
Select the Create SMS file check box.
3.
Provide the name of the application you are installing in the Install MIF Filename field.
4.
Provide the name of the application to be uninstalled in the Uninstall MIF Filename field.
5.
Enter the serial number for the product in the Serial Number field.
The resulting file has a .MIF extension.

Creating a Setup.exe File for the Package and Transform
Task:
To create a Setup.exe file to begin the installation of your base package and transform:
1.
From the checklist, select Package, and then select Setup from the second column. The Setup View of the
Package View opens.
2.
Select the Create Installation Launcher (Setup.exe) check box.
3.
Specify whether you want to include the Windows 95/98 or Windows NT MSI engines.
4.
Provide any command-line arguments for your installation.
5.
Save your transform. The Setup.exe file is stored in the directory specified in the Location panel of the
Packaging Wizard, or in the Location view within the Package view.
